USGS 02088500 LITTLE RIVER NEAR PRINCETON, NC

  Stream Site

DESCRIPTION:
Latitude 35°30'41",   Longitude 78°09'37"   NAD83
Johnston County, North Carolina, Hydrologic Unit 03020201
Drainage area: 232 square miles
Datum of gage: 106.8 feet above   NAVD88.
